President Uhuru Kenyatta today held talks with the Archbishop of Canterbury, the Most Reverend Justin Welby.
Archbishop Welby hailed the progress Kenya has made since his last visit in the country 42 years ago. He recalled - with nostalgia - his meeting with founding President Mzee Jomo Kenyatta when he served as a volunteer teacher in Central Kenya.
